Questionnaire:

1) Do you drink at least 8 cups of water every day?

2) Do you exercise regularly?

3) Do you have a balanced diet?

4) Do you smoke?

5) Do you drink alcohol often?

6) Do you feel tired often?

7) Do you experience often any sort of pain?

8) Do you get sick often?

My mother's answers:

1) I don't think so, maybe around 5 o 6 a day.

2) Yes, about 3 to 4 times a week.

3) Yes.

4) Unfortunately, yes.

5) Only on social events.

6) Yes, I work a lot.

7) Yes, mostly back pain.

8) No, I rarely get sick.

My predictions:

According to the answers my mother gave in this questionnaire, I would assume she isn't in a bad shape but she's not super healthy either. She has a balanced diet and exercises regularly, which are necessary things, but she smokes and that's very unhealthy. Given that she experiences back pain often, I would recommend her to go to the doctor.
